1. Understanding Psychiatry’s Scope

Psychiatry, as a specialized medical discipline, encompasses a wide array of functions and responsibilities. It involves the study of mental disorders, their origins, manifestations, and effective treatment approaches. Psychiatrists are medical doctors who undergo rigorous training to gain expertise in identifying, diagnosing, and managing various mental health conditions.

Diagnostic Expertise: Psychiatrists employ their clinical acumen to diagnose conditions such as depression, anxiety disorders, bipolar disorder, schizophrenia, and more. They meticulously assess patients’ symptoms, history, and behavior to arrive at accurate diagnoses.

Holistic Approach: Psychiatry adopts a holistic approach that considers not only the biological aspects of mental health but also psychological, social, and environmental factors. This comprehensive view aids in developing personalized treatment plans.

Therapeutic Interventions: Beyond diagnosis, psychiatrists are skilled in providing a range of therapeutic interventions, including psychotherapy, medication management, c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), and more.

2. Importance of Psychiatry in Mental Health Care

The significance of psychiatry in modern mental health care cannot be overstated. Mental health conditions affect millions globally, and psychiatry serves as a beacon of hope for those seeking effective solutions to manage and overcome these challenges.

Reducing Stigma: Psychiatry contributes to reducing the stigma surrounding mental illnesses by promoting awareness and understanding. Through education and advocacy, psychiatrists strive to create an inclusive environment for individuals with mental health conditions.

Enhancing Quality of Life: By providing accurate diagnoses and tailored treatments, psychiatry aids in improving individuals’ quality of life. Effective management of mental health conditions enables people to lead fulfilling and productive lives.

Preventive Measures: Psychiatry is instrumental in preventive mental health care. Psychiatrists work to identify early signs of mental health issues and intervene proactively to prevent the exacerbation of symptoms.

3. Collaborative Care and Research

Collaboration and research are integral components of psychiatry that contribute to its growth and development.

Interdisciplinary Collaboration: Psychiatrists often collaborate with psychologists, social workers, nurses, and other medical professionals to ensure comprehensive care for patients. This interdisciplinary approach addresses the diverse needs of individuals.

Advancements in Treatment: Ongoing research in psychiatry leads to the discovery of innovative treatment modalities. From advancements in psychopharmacology to breakthroughs in neurobiology, research drives the evolution of effective treatments.

Exploring Brain-Mind Connection: Psychiatry explores the intricate relationship between the brain and the mind. This exploration sheds light on the neural mechanisms underlying emotions, thoughts, and behaviors.

4. Addressing Global Mental Health Challenges

In a world facing increasing mental health challenges, psychiatry plays a pivotal role in addressing societal and global concerns.

Disaster and Trauma Response: Psychiatrists play a vital role in disaster response and trauma management. Their expertise helps individuals cope with the psychological aftermath of natural disasters, accidents, and other traumatic events.

Community Mental Health: Psychiatry extends beyond clinical settings to address community mental health needs. Initiatives led by psychiatrists aim to promote mental well-being at societal levels.

Advocacy for Policy Changes: Psychiatrists often advocate for policy changes that enhance mental health services, accessibility, and affordability. Their voices contribute to shaping a more inclusive mental health care system.
